On 2/13/2020,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Helen Estrella conducted an unannounced visit to the facility to conduct a 1-year required inspection. Upon arrival, LPA met with the Teacher Tina Paek and informed the nature of the visit. The Director arrived 30 minutes later. LPA confirmed with the Director that all adults present at the facility have obtained a criminal record clearance and/or exemption and appear to be associated to the facility. LPA was guided on a tour of the facility (inside and outside).

The facility is housed within William Green Elementary. The faciilty utilizes two preschool classrooms and operates an AM program from 8:00 AM to 11:00 AM. LPA observed a census of 42 preschool children being supervised by a total of 6 staff. The following supervision of child to adult ratios were observed: "P1 room: 20 children with 3 staff; P2 room: 20 children with 3 staff.

LPA observed each classroom equipped for learning, games and activities. Furniture and equipment was inspected for age appropriateness and good repair. The telephone service, heating, lighting, and ventilation is adequate in each classroom. There is drinking water in the classroom. Cubbies were observed for children's belongings. There is a first aid kits in each classroom. There are equipped 2A10BC fire extinguishers in each classroom. LPA observed several age appropriate games, toys and balls for outside play. There is a separate area for isolation and care of ill children in the library area of the classroom. The bathrooms are located inside the classrooms. The toilets and faucets were inspected and are functioning properly and are age appropriate. The water temperature is appropriate. LPA observed a refrigerator and a microwave oven. The facility provides a morning breakfast only, all meals are delivered by Lawndale School District. Menus are posted. The chemicals and cleaning supplies are kept high above the sink and inaccessible to children in care.

Inspection of the outdoor play area was conducted. Climbing structures, swings, slides and other large play equipment is found to be securely anchored with adequate resilient cushioning material underneath and around the perimeter. Drinking water is readily available on the play yard. The is adequate shade for the children in care. Fencing around the perimeter of the play area is at least 4 feet high. Playground is free from miscellaneous debris such as tree branches, trash, leaves, etc.

LPA reviewed children's records and were observed complete with CCLD forms. The facility roster was up to date and at least one staff is currently certified with Pediatric CPR/First Aid that expires on 09/2020.

The facility provides Incidental Medical Services (IMS) at this time. LPA reviewed medication list and allergy plans for children and it was observed that each medicine is appropriately stored and labeled.

For IMS information see Evaluator Manual - Regulation Interpretations and Procedures for Child Care Centers Sections 101173 and 101226. The following information regarding ADA was provided: US Department of Justice (USDOJ) toll-free ADA Information Line at (800) 514-0301 (voice)/ (800) 514-0383 (TTY) and link to publication: Commonly Asked Questions about Child Care Centers and the ADA, available at:http://www.ada.gov/childqanda.htm. Incidental Medical Services Include: Blood-Glucose Monitoring for Diabetic Children, Administering Inhaled Medication, Administering EpiPen Jr. and EpiPen or other Epinephrine Auto-Injectors, Glucagon Administration, Gastrostomy Tube Care (G-tube care), Insulin Injections Administration, Anti-Seizure Administration, and Carrying out medical orders when the child’s physician has determined that a layperson can be trained and safely carry out the orders.

The facility was informed of the following during today's inspection:
Mandated Reporter: Beginning on January 1, 2018, AB 1207, requires all licensed providers, applicants, directors and employees to complete training as specified on their mandated reporter duties and to renew their training every two years. Volunteers are encouraged but not required to take the training. The OCAP modules are free of cost and available at: http://www.mandatedreporterca.com/.

Licensee was made aware of The Child Care Advocate Program (CCAP) that is administered from within the Community Care Licensing Division. CCAP participates in many community activities and special projects in order to disseminate information on the State’s licensing role, provide information to the public and parents on child care licensing, and provide many other helpful resources to the licensees and the public. CCAP’s direct contact information is as followed: Phone number: (916) 654-1541 childcareadvocatesprogram@dss.ca.gov

The licensee was informed of the responsibility to report suspected Child Abuse by calling the Child Abuse Hot line at 1-800-540-4000. Also call the CCL office within 24 hours of the Unusual Incident and follow up with a written Unusual Incident/Injury Report (LIC 624B) within 7 business days.

Lead Bill - Health & Safety Code 1596.7996. Licensee was made aware of AB 2370, requiring a licensed child day care center located in a building constructed before January 1, 2010, to have its drinking water tested for lead contamination and to let parents or legal guardians of children enrolled about the requirement to test and result of the tests.

The licensee was informed how to obtain quarterly reports, forms, and regulations for Child Care online at www.ccld.ca.gov. Licensee was also encouraged to read the Child Care quarterly updates every season as the come out to stay informed of any changes or updates to the regulations. Licensee encourage to inform staff of viewing child care videos that explain licensing topics relevant to families and child care providers at: https://ccld.childcarevideos.org

The licensee was advised that, once licensed, the Notice of Site Visit must be posted at the entrance of the facility for a period of 30 days. If a serious violation is cited, (Type A violation), a copy of the licensing report (LIC809 or LIC9099) must also be posted for 30 days. If these requirements are not met, civil penalties in the amount of $100 per violation will be assessed. The applicant was made aware that a licensee may file an appeal, in writing 15 business days from the date of receiving the penalty assessment.

The facility appears to be operating within substantial compliance. A copy of this report and a Notice of Site Visit was provided to the Director and an exit interview conducted.
